Heads up, support folks — quick changelog note for CrashFunnel 3.2. We renamed the old REPORT_UPLOAD_CREDS setting because people kept confusing it with the symbol-upload token, and honestly the old name was a mess. The pipeline won't ingest crash reports from the Lumabird app until the new variable is in place, so if a customer says reports stopped after upgrading, this is almost always why. Have them open their .env file, delete the old line entirely, and add the renamed entry as follows:

env line for fafof-fahag: LEDGER_TOKEN5=f8790

Fan-out backpressure for the Quillet notifier: when the queue depth crosses the soft limit, the dispatcher sheds low-priority pushes and batches the rest at 500ms intervals. Reviewer should confirm the shed counter is exported and that retries respect the jitter window. Once merged, the release artifact gets re-signed by the pipeline, which expects the deploy key shown below.

deploy key for bawep-yawif: bky6_GQhaSt

Hi all — quick note from the front desk at Wrenfield Point. We've had a few visitors wandering up unescorted lately, so a reminder: team assistants should meet their guests in the lobby, not wave them through. Sign-in tablet first, lanyard second, then up you go together. If you're collecting someone after 18:00, the lobby turnstiles switch to keypad mode, so you'll need the code below.

staff pass of kawip-hawef = bdg-QLP-2

Blue-green deploys for the Ledgerbee billing worker follow the standard pattern: stand up the green pool, drain invoices from blue, then flip the router once queue depth hits zero. Never flip mid-batch — partial invoice runs are painful to reconcile. Before promoting green, the release artifact must be verified against the key below.

release key, bahap-kafof: bky3_KHo

## Service accounts: FD leak hunt

The `fdwatch` service account exists solely for the Bramblegate descriptor-leak investigation. It can read process metrics on prod hosts, nothing else. Run the sweep script hourly; flag any process exceeding 4,000 open descriptors. Do not reuse this account for other tooling. The account authenticates to the metrics collector with the key below.

service key, yajef-kajef: kto11_OoNe9JNSuFD